What Are Natural Skincare Products?

Natural skincare products are made with ingredients derived from plants, minerals, and other naturally occurring sources. They typically avoid synthetic chemicals, artificial fragrances, and harsh preservatives.

Common Ingredients in Natural Skincare

✔ Aloe vera – Soothes and hydrates the skin
✔ Tea tree oil – Fights acne-causing bacteria
✔ Rosehip oil – Brightens and nourishes the skin
✔ Shea butter – Deeply moisturizes and repairs
✔ Green tea extract – Provides antioxidants and anti-aging benefits

Are Natural Skincare Products Always Safe?

While natural does not always mean safe, many consumers assume that if an ingredient is plant-based, it is automatically good for the skin. However, natural skincare can still cause allergic reactions, breakouts, or irritation.

Common Issues with Natural Skincare

✔ Essential oils like citrus or peppermint can cause irritation and photosensitivity.
✔ Raw apple cider vinegar can disrupt the skin’s pH balance.
✔ Coconut oil can clog pores and lead to breakouts, especially for oily skin.
✔ Botanical extracts may trigger allergic reactions in sensitive individuals.

How to Use Natural Skincare Safely

✔ Patch test new products before applying them to your face.
✔ Avoid ingredients that are known to be irritating for your skin type.
✔ Choose formulated products rather than DIY skincare to ensure proper ingredient balance.

How Do Natural Skincare Products Compare to Synthetic Products?

While natural skincare offers many benefits, scientifically formulated synthetic skincare has advantages that cannot be ignored.

Advantages of Synthetic Skincare Products

✔ More Stable Formulations – Lab-created ingredients like hyaluronic acid and peptides are tested for efficacy and stability, ensuring consistent results.
✔ Longer Shelf Life – Natural products spoil faster without preservatives.
✔ Advanced Ingredients – Lab-made ingredients like retinol, ceramides, and niacinamide have been clinically proven to improve skin health.

Are Natural Skincare Products Effective for All Skin Types?

Not all natural skincare products work for every skin type. Understanding your skin’s needs is essential when choosing between natural and synthetic skincare.

Best Natural Ingredients for Different Skin Types

✔ For Dry Skin: Shea butter, jojoba oil, hyaluronic acid
✔ For Oily Skin: Witch hazel, tea tree oil, aloe vera
✔ For Sensitive Skin: Oat extract, chamomile, centella asiatica
✔ For Acne-Prone Skin: Green tea, niacinamide, willow bark extract

While natural skincare can be beneficial, some skin conditions require medical-grade skincare, such as prescription retinoids for acne or synthetic peptides for anti-aging.

Myths About Natural Skincare

There are many misconceptions about natural skincare that need to be debunked.

Myth #1: Natural Skincare Is Always Better for Your Skin

Not all natural ingredients are beneficial. Some plant-based extracts cause irritation or allergic reactions, just like synthetic ones.

Myth #2: Chemical-Free Products Are Safer

Everything is made of chemicals, including water. The key is understanding which chemicals are safe and which ones to avoid.

Myth #3: Natural Skincare Works Faster

Unlike clinical-grade treatments, natural skincare products may take longer to show results because they contain lower concentrations of active ingredients.
